Transaction f3408bf586414160a24c9c1786dd1bc50deb54e725469cf8c7f371ad16a14033

1 Input
2 Outputs
  • f3408bf586414160a24c9c1786dd1bc50deb54e725469cf8c7f371ad16a14033:0
  • value  876000
    address  3PFv2ANTFFJDLuqXRADbTHpYZHXYcm7AzA
  • f3408bf586414160a24c9c1786dd1bc50deb54e725469cf8c7f371ad16a14033:1
  • value  2129008
    address  35ec9EuxZic4BjaTNYwdy8vLbT65ScC645